Macos OTA 升级后Web服务器报403错误

It works!正常 Apache 服务器已正常开启;

phpinfo();

上传PHP探针,查PHP未启动,未升级之前是正常使用的;

啥原因不管了,直接开启就是;

Apache服务默认安装在/etc/apache2目录下。在Finder(访达)中,默认状态下,是找不到此路径的。我们可以通过前往(快捷键:command+shift+g)文件夹的方式,进入到该文件夹,打开httpd.conf。

#LoadModule phpXXX…,将其前面的#号去掉(去掉注释)即可。

[tl_donate_required id=”sPXKPMAcVd6055e8423a396″][ttreward2v]
伪静态设置方法:直接将目录设置成777权限,sudo chmod -R 777;
打开 apache2/httpd.conf 这个文件找到
LoadModule rewrite_module libexec/apache2/mod_rewrite.so
把前面的 # 去掉,保存。这样就支持rewrite了。
然后,依然是这个文件,搜索
AllowOverride None
一共有三处,全部改为
AllowOverride All
也就是让服务器支持.htaccess文件
[/ttreward2v][/tl_donate_required]

执行Apache相关命令:

sudo apachectl start #启动

sudo apachectl stop #停止

sudo apachectl restart #重启

web服务器正常!!

© 除特别注明外,本站所有文章均为 我的自留地 原创,转载请注明出处来自 https://mehuts.com/2225.html

THE END
喜欢就支持一下吧
点赞0
分享
评论 抢沙发

请登录后发表评论